Warm welcome for international colleagues
New international colleagues received a warm welcome to Leeds during our inaugural reception event.
Professor Hai-Sui Yu, Deputy Vice-Chancellor: International, speaking at the welcome reception

Hosted by Professor Hai-Sui Yu, Deputy Vice-Chancellor: International, the occasion held at University House was designed to welcome new staff to Leeds and offer them the opportunity to learn about our international strategy and vision.
Colleagues getting to know each other at the international staff welcome reception
The reception was attended by colleagues from a range of faculties and professional services who have recently joined the University from overseas. Presentations were given by the International HR team, the International Office and Research and Innovation. Colleagues engaged in discussion with the speakers and facilitators, and had the chance to meet other recently-appointed international staff from across campus.
Lucy Omidiran, HR Officer (International), and International Office Director, Jacqui Brown, addressing colleagues at the event
The next welcome reception is scheduled for October 2019, and will now take place biannually.
